Colorful Boho Glam Texas Hill Country Wedding Bouquet
- 5 Stems Romantic Antique Garden Roses
- 3 Stems Caramel Antique Garden Roses
- 2 Stems Sarah Peonies
- 3 Stems Red Charm Peonies
- 2 Stems Burgundy Dahlia
- 3 Stems Blush Larkspur
- 6 Stems Blue Thistle
- 7 Stems Magenta Anemone
- 5 Stems Red Scabiosa
- 6 Stems Blue Veronica
- 3 Stems White Japanese Andromeda
- 3 Stems Sunset Coral Ranunculus
- 3 Stems Hot Pink Ranunculus
- 3 Stems Blush Ranunculus
- 2 Stems Blush Heather
- 5 Stems Plumosa Fern Foliage
- 5 Stems Bay Laurel Foliage
- 3 Stems Camellia Greens
- 1 Yard 3″-Wide Fuschia Chainette Fringe
From Ashlyn Gibbens Hobbs of Sweet Magnolia Floral… Located in the heart of the Texas Hill Country, most of the weddings we design at Sweet Magnolia are destination weddings. Because family and friends have traveled so far to help celebrate, it is really important that the flowers reflect the unique personalities of our clients and truly encompass the vision each couple has for their wedding day! Known for lush bouquets and garden style arrangements, our designs at Sweet Magnolia are full of seasonal materials sourced from local farmers and our aesthetic is one driven by the nature around us.
